    Hyperforce is a complete re-architecture of Salesforce's platform, built to be more flexible, scalable, and secure while maintaining the core principles of Salesforce's multi-tenant, metadata-driven platform.
    Hyperforce has been designed to deliver all of Salesforce's apps, services, and systems on public cloud infrastructure. It's built on a scalable architecture that allows Salesforce to run on any public cloud, with a lower cost and higher compute capacity.
    Development-wise, Salesforce used a lot of open-source technology to create Hyperforce. The core idea is to bring Salesforce to the data, rather than the data to Salesforce. So, they designed Hyperforce to be able to operate in data centers around the world.
    To ensure security, Salesforce uses its existing methods like at-rest encryption, but they also add additional layers of security when they transport data to and from these public clouds.
